Saturday 22 May 2021 at 2pm GMT
A Zoom talk entitled:
The Hero of the Oak Tree,

Colonel Carless, the Catholic Recusant who saved King Charles II.
Colonel William Carless fought in the Royalist Army against the Parliamentarians at the Battle of Worcester and was a pivotal figure in the King’s escape survival.
Our speaker is Elaine T. Joyce, the author of the book Nine Witnesses for the Colonel – King Charles II’s Most True and Loyal Friend. Elaine has researched this subject thoroughly and gives insights into the lives and hardships of some of the ordinary Catholic people of Staffordshire in the seventeenth century.
